    When trying to edit a Page, neither the Add Media nor the Text button do anything. The Text button (to swap to HTML) goes red when I hover my cursor over it, but nothing happens when I click on it.

    Many other people have reported this, or similar, problems; but I can’t see any reported fix. Is anyone working on it ? Is there a separate WordPress log of known bugs somewhere, so we can stop reporting the same problem ?

    The standard troubleshooting steps (mentioned in many threads) are:
    Clear your browser and any server caches

    Deactivate ALL plugins

    Clear any caches and cookies again.

    Reset plugins folder (using FTP change the name on the plugins folder to something else temporarily)

    Clear any caches and cookies again.

    Switch to the default theme

    Clear any caches and cookies again.

    If the problem is solved, reverse the above one by one to see what’s causing the problem.

    Incidentally, my workaround for the Attachment problem is to type in the Media item’s directly, e.g. <webaddress>/wp-content/uploads/2013/04/<filename>. Inelegant, but it works.

    Alternatively, editing my Profile to disable the Visual Editor enabled me to type in HTML, i.e. it overrides the failure of the Text button.

    The only solution that worked for me was to delete all the old files and then completely re-uploaded all new WP files. Only files I didn’t delete were the ones I uploaded in wp-content.

    I just read on the ‘SiteGround’ blog that a solution is to install a plugin called “Use Google Libraries”. I tried it myself and… HEY PRESTO! … all the buttons started to work. Worth a try.
    [Note: I had only just created my WP website, using the latest version (5.5.2) and the default ‘Twenty Twelve’ theme, so I was pretty sure the other suggestions wouldn’t apply to me.]
